Event summary
The Trilhos do Pastor 2026 is a trail running event scheduled for April 26, 2026, in Pia do Urso, Batalha, Portugal, near Fátima. It features multiple distances including a 35.5 km Trail, a 17.5 km Trail Sprint, a 12 km Mini-Trail, and a non-competitive 12 km walk, making it accessible for various levels of trail runners and walkers.
Open to all participants, the event is organized by Atlético Clube São Mamede with support from local municipalities. The routes traverse mostly ancient trails and paths in the natural park of the Serras Aire and Candeeiros, passing unique landmarks such as caves, old Roman roads, and scenic viewpoints with vistas of famous mountain ranges and the Sanctuary of Fátima.
The race atmosphere combines the spirit of competition with the enjoyment of nature’s beauty, and includes a Kids Run on the day before, designed to promote athletics among youth with distances tailored by age categories. This makes the Trilhos do Pastor a family-friendly event celebrating trail running culture in a spectacular environment.

Age categories/divisions:
• Trail and Trail Sprint: general male/female, age group categories
• Mini-Trail: top 5 male and female overall
• Kids Run: Benjamins A (6-9), Benjamins B (10-11), Infantis (12-13), Iniciados (14-15), plus open category for under 5
Start/finish locations: Pia do Urso, Batalha, Portugal
Start times per category/distance:
• Trail (35.5 km): 08:00
• Mini-Trail (12 km) and Caminhada (12 km walk): 08:30
• Trail Sprint (17.5 km): 09:00
• Kids Run: April 25 from 15:00 to 17:00
Cut-off times: Trail: 8 hours total; 4h at 2nd aid station, 7h at 4th aid station
Bib pick-up time and location:
• April 25, 14:00–18:00
• April 26, 06:30 onwards
• Location: Pia do Urso secretariat
Participants limit:
• Trail: 200
• Trail Sprint: 400
• Mini-Trail: 250
• Caminhada: 250
• Kids Run: 150
Registration deadline: Until participant limits are reached
Surface types: Approximately 95% trails and old paths in limestone massif of Serras Aire and Candeeiros
Course format: Point-to-point and looped trails with marked routes and signage
Race routes: Trails pass through natural parks, caves, Roman roads, and scenic viewpoints with vistas of regional mountain ranges and the Sanctuary of Fátima
Toilets and aid station placement: Several aid stations with hydration and food, locations detailed in regulation
Prizes: Monetary prizes for top 3 in Trail general, trophies for top finishers in Trail Sprint and Mini-Trail, medals for finishers, and awards for teams and age groups
